WebBreast Reduction Surgery Preliminary Requirements 6 month documentations of all conservative measures that have been taken to relieve pain/discomfort Rashes: treatment with either prescription and over the counter medication/creams. Back pain/neck pain: seen by chiropractor or physical therapy use of prescription or over the WebMay 25, 2024 · Signs that breast reduction may be of benefit to you include: Persistent back pain, shoulder or neck pain that does not resolve with other treatments. Poor posture due to large breasts. Indentations from bra straps. Arm numbness or tingling. Breast size limits the ability to be physically active. Persistent skin irritation beneath the breast ...
